The Ph.D. in Commerce and Management at Ramchandra Chandravansi University (RCU), Palamu, is a full-time doctoral research programme of three years (minimum) under the Faculty of Commerce and Management. Candidates holding an MBA, M.Com, or equivalent PG degree are eligible. The programme is UGC-recognised and covers independent research in finance, marketing, human resource management, and organisational behaviour. Total minimum fees are INR 3,31,000 over three years. UGC-NET or JRF qualified candidates may be exempted from the university’s entrance test.

Ramchandra Chandravansi University Ph.D Commerce and Management Fees

ComponentAmount (INR)
Tuition Fee (Year 1)INR 1,00,000
Prospectus Fee (one-time)INR 1,000
Admission Fee (one-time)INR 10,000
Registration Fee (one-time)INR 10,000
Research Registration/Exam Fee (one-time)INR 10,000
Tuition Fee (Year 2)INR 1,00,000
Tuition Fee (Year 3)INR 1,00,000
Total Fees (3 Years Minimum)INR 3,31,000
  • Annual tuition fee is INR 1,00,000 per year as per the official fee structure published by RCU.
  • One-time charges payable in the first year include a prospectus fee of INR 1,000, admission fee of INR 10,000, registration fee of INR 10,000, and a research registration fee of INR 10,000.
  • Total fees for the minimum three-year Ph.D. programme amount to INR 3,31,000. Candidates extending beyond three years are required to pay tuition of INR 1,00,000 per additional year.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Candidates must hold a Master’s degree in Commerce, Management, or a closely related discipline (MBA, M.Com, or equivalent) from a recognised university with a minimum of 55 percent marks (50 percent for SC/ST/OBC/PwD as per UGC norms).
  • UGC-NET or UGC-JRF qualified candidates are preferred; JRF holders are eligible for research fellowship support.
  • Working professionals with relevant industry experience may also be considered for part-time PhD enrolment, subject to faculty availability and university norms.

Admission Process

  • Visit rcu.edu.in and fill the online PhD application form under the Faculty of Commerce and Management.
  • Upload PG degree mark sheets, provisional certificate, UGC-NET/JRF scorecard (if applicable), and a brief research proposal.
  • Appear in the university’s PhD entrance test; UGC-NET/JRF qualified candidates may be exempted.
  • Attend the research interview and proposal presentation before the doctoral committee.
  • Complete enrolment formalities and pay first-year fees; register with the assigned research supervisor.

Ramchandra Chandravansi University Ph.D Commerce and Management Scholarships 2026

ScholarshipAmountEligibility
UGC-JRF FellowshipINR 37,000/month (Year 1-2)UGC-NET JRF qualified candidates; awarded by UGC directly
Post Matric Scholarship (Jharkhand Govt.)As per government normsSC/ST/OBC students from Jharkhand; applied via National Scholarship Portal
University Research GrantAs notified by RCUFull-time PhD scholars with exceptional research output; subject to faculty recommendation
  • UGC-JRF fellows must register and maintain their fellowship through UGC’s scholarship portal; the fellowship is enhanced to INR 42,000 per month from the third year onward.
  • Government scholarships for SC/ST/OBC scholars are processed through the National Scholarship Portal at scholarships.gov.in; apply before the notified deadlines.
